Marcus Thiese wrote:
Maybe I don't understand the structure of this VIDIX stuff but shouldn't it be possible to detect the overlay on runtime? Thomas Winschhofer's sisctrl can do it, so your driver should be able to do so to. I don't wanna sound unfriendly, I'm just not really happy whith having to set an environment variable when I want to watch a movie.
SiSCtrl doesn't directly access the hardware. It talks to the X Server, and the X Server does the hardware handling.
I think the xvidix driver is a great way to test VIDIX development, but Xv is a better option for real playback, since it's better integreated with X11.
But shouldn't the xvidix driver be faster? If it directly accesses the graphics card it should and I'm always heading for speed :-)
And what, if not "directly accessing the graphics card", do you think the X Server does? Thomas -- Thomas Winischhofer Vienna/Austria thomas AT winischhofer DOT net *** http://www.winischhofer.net/ twini AT xfree86 DOT org
